Hyper-V

AMD 和 Intel 處理器之間的 Hyper-V 離線遷移

  • February 14, 2015

我有一個使用 Dell R715 AMD 機器的現有 3 伺服器 hyperv 集群。

現在我正在計劃如果我們的伺服器機房在災難中受損該怎麼辦。計劃是讓一個相當強大的伺服器在另一個位置等待恢復。這些位置通過 50mbit 連接進行連接。

如果我們有一些警告,我想在不同位置之間遷移虛擬機。如果沒有,我們將從異地備份中恢復。

問題是:戴爾的新伺服器都沒有 AMD 處理器。將 AMD 和 Intel 處理器混合使用並不理想,但淘汰 AMD 伺服器不在我的預算之內——而且由於 AMD 伺服器似乎正在逐步淘汰,我不想被困在購買較舊的伺服器上。

我知道您無法在 AMD 和 Intel 處理器之間進行實時遷移。但是你可以在虛擬機關閉的情況下這樣做嗎?

有幾種情況我不知道我是否會遇到問題:

  • 將備份從在 AMD 處理器上執行的 VM 恢復到執行 Intel 處理器的主機。我懷疑這會造成問題,但你永遠不知道。
  • Hyper-V 副本 - 可以在 AMD 和 Intel 伺服器之間完成嗎?
  • 關閉電源的虛擬機的實時/快速遷移 - Hyper-V 工具是否允許我以這種方式遷移關閉的虛擬機,還是仍會檢查處理器兼容性?我是導出/導入 VM 的唯一選擇嗎?

在停止和啟動 VM 的情況下,在不同處理器類型之間移動應該不會遇到任何問題。(例如導出和導入。)

離線移動

如果這些是集群節點,並且集群節點中有不同類型的處理器,並且您想將 VM 從一個節點移動(但仍不是實時遷移)到另一個節點,則需要在“處理器兼容性”中啟動 VM “ 模式。

處理器兼容模式

但是,儘管聽起來像,“處理器兼容性”模式仍然不允許您跨具有不同處理器類型的機器進行實時遷移。

引用自:https://serverfault.com/questions/652196